| Shape Memory Alloy (SMA) Engineer |
Design, develop, and test SMA-based components for smart appliances. Requires strong problem-solving skills and expertise in materials science. |
| Smart Appliance Design Engineer (SMA Focus) |
Integrate SMA technology into innovative appliance designs, optimizing performance and energy efficiency. Collaboration with multidisciplinary teams is key. |
| SMA Applications Specialist |
Research and explore new applications for SMAs in the smart appliance industry. Involves market research and collaboration with manufacturers. |
| Robotics Engineer (SMA Actuators) |
Develop and implement SMA-actuated robotic systems for smart home appliances. A deep understanding of robotics and control systems is crucial. |

The Certified Specialist Programme in Shape Memory Alloys for Smart Appliances provides comprehensive training on the design, application, and integration of shape memory alloys (SMAs) in cutting-edge smart appliance technology. This specialized program equips participants with the knowledge and skills necessary to contribute effectively to this rapidly evolving field.
Learning outcomes include a deep understanding of SMA material properties, thermo-mechanical behavior, actuation mechanisms, and design considerations for smart appliances. Participants will gain practical experience through hands-on projects, simulations, and case studies, developing proficiency in SMA-based device design and troubleshooting. This program directly addresses the growing demand for engineers and technicians skilled in this niche area of materials science and engineering.
